2,663,364,347,160,165,001 is an odd composite number composed of three prime numbers multiplied together.
2663364347160165001 is an odd composite number. It is composed of three dist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of eight divisors.
Prime factorization of 2663364347160165001:
19 × 37 × 3788569483869367
